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on current industry data, the South Korea alloy handle market was valued at approximately USD 1.2 billion

in 2023. This valuation considers the combined revenues from manufacturing, distribution, and aftermarket services across key end-user segments such as construction, furniture, automotive, and consumer electronics.

Assuming a steady macroeconomic environment, technological adoption, and rising infrastructure investments, the market is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% to 7.0%

over the next five years, reaching an estimated USD 1.8 billion to USD 2.0 billion

by 2028. The projection incorporates realistic assumptions about supply chain stability, raw material costs, and technological innovation trajectories.

Market Ecosystem & Demand-Supply Framework

Key Product Categories

  • Standard Alloy Handles:

    Basic handles made from aluminum, zinc, or magnesium alloys suitable for general applications.

  • Premium Alloy Handles:

    High-strength, corrosion-resistant handles incorporating advanced alloys like titanium or composite materials.

  • Smart Alloy Handles:

    Incorporating sensors, connectivity modules, and embedded electronics for IoT-enabled functionalities.

Stakeholders & Value Chain

  • Raw Material Suppliers:

    Aluminum, zinc, magnesium, titanium, and specialty alloy providers.

  • Component Manufacturers:

    Firms specializing in casting, machining, surface treatment, and assembly of alloy handles.

  • Distribution & Logistics:

    Distributors, wholesalers, and e-commerce platforms facilitating market reach.

  • End-Users:

    Construction firms, furniture manufacturers, automotive OEMs, electronics companies, and consumers.

  • Service & Maintenance Providers:

    Lifecycle support, refurbishment, and aftermarket services.

Demand-Supply Framework & Revenue Models

The market operates on a B2B and B2C basis, with raw material procurement forming a significant cost component (~40%). Manufacturing margins typically range from 15% to 25%, influenced by automation levels and material costs. Distribution channels include direct sales, OEM partnerships, and online platforms, with aftermarket sales contributing approximately 10-15% of total revenue. Lifecycle services, including maintenance and upgrades, are emerging as value-added revenue streams, especially for smart handle solutions.

Cost Structures, Pricing Strategies, and Risk Factors

  • Cost Structures:

    Raw materials (~40%), manufacturing (~25%), R&D (~10%), distribution (~10%), and overheads (~15%).

  • Pricing Strategies:

    Premium pricing for high-performance and smart handles; volume discounts for bulk OEM orders; value-based pricing for customized solutions.

  • Capital Investment Patterns:

    Significant investments in automation, R&D, and digital infrastructure to maintain competitive advantage.

Key Risks & Challenges

  • Regulatory & Environmental Compliance:

    Stringent regulations on material sourcing and emissions can impact costs and supply chains.

  • Cybersecurity Threats:

    Increasing connectivity heightens vulnerability to cyberattacks, especially for smart handle solutions.

  • Raw Material Price Volatility:

    Fluctuations in alloy raw material prices can compress margins.

  • Competitive Intensity:

    Rapid technological advancements and low entry barriers pose risks of commoditization.
